Patricia L. Dodge is the Managing Partner of Meyer, Unkovic & Scott.

 

For more than thirty years as a trial attorney, Ms. Dodge has represented a wide range of foreign and domestic corporations, closely-held businesses, municipal agencies, and individuals in connection with complex commercial litigation, securities fraud, products liability and land use litigation.  As principal trial counsel, she advocates for her clients in state and federal courts by using innovative trial techniques and where appropriate, alternative dispute resolution.  Over the course of her career, Ms. Dodge has secured for her clients several multi-million verdicts, including a $104 million verdict in a breach of contract action.

 

Ms. Dodge also represents her clients in domestic and international arbitration proceedings, including in matters before the International Chamber of Commerce and the Swiss Chambers’ Arbitration, Zurich Chamber of Commerce.  She is an arbitrator for the American Arbitration Association and also serves as a private arbitrator.  In addition, Ms. Dodge frequently serves as a mediator and neutral evaluator in lawsuits pending in federal court. 

 

Ms. Dodge has been elected as a Fellow of the International Academy of Trial Lawyers, the American College of Trial Lawyers and the Academy of Trial Lawyers of Allegheny County.  She is the Past-President of the Academy of Trial Lawyers of Allegheny County.  She has been selected for inclusion in “The Best Lawyers of America,” published by Woodward & White, since 2007 and was named by Best Lawyers as Pittsburgh Lawyer of the Year 2012 in Products Liability Litigation-Defendants.  She has also been named as a Pennsylvania “Super Lawyer” by the publisher of Law & Politics Magazine every year since 2005, as well as one of the top fifty lawyers in Pittsburgh.

 

Ms. Dodge received a Bachelor of Science degree with high distinction from the Pennsylvania State University in 1974.  She earned her Juris Doctor Degree cum laude in 1981 from Duquesne University School of Law, where she served on the Duquesne Law Review.

 

Ms. Dodge is admitted to practice in Pennsylvania and in the United States District Court for the Eastern, Middle, and Western Districts of Pennsylvania, the District of Maryland and the District of Columbia, the United States Court of Appeals for the Third Circuit and the United States Supreme Court.  She is a member of the Allegheny County, Pennsylvania and American Bar Associations, as well as the International Association of Defense Counsel.

 

Ms. Dodge is an adjunct professor at the University Pittsburgh School of Law where she teaches Advanced Trial Evidence.  She is a Trustee of the Allegheny County Bar Foundation and a hearing officer for the Pennsylvania Disciplinary Board. 

 

Ms. Dodge serves as President of the Council of the Borough of Thornburg, where she resides with her husband,  Howard Schulberg.
